Visual Enhancements That Breathe Life Into the World
One of the first things you will notice upon loading into a world with CozyCorners is the visual fidelity. The pack integrates Fresh Animations and Not Enough Animations to give mobs and players fluid, natural movements that replace the stiff, robotic motions of the base game. Combined with Skin Layers 3D, your character and other players appear with detailed depth. The environment gets a major upgrade too, thanks to Motschen's Better Leaves for lush foliage and reimagined textures for chests, lanterns, and buckets. These changes are subtle individually but collectively transform the aesthetic from pixelated to picturesque.
For those who crave even more graphical prowess, the pack includes built-in support for Iris Shaders. You can instantly switch between stunning presets like Complementary Reimagined, Complementary Unbound, or Mellow. These shader packs bring breathtaking skies, dynamic shadows, and realistic water reflections, all optimized to run smoothly even on mid-range hardware thanks to the inclusion of Sodium.
Immersive Soundscapes and Quality of Life
Sight is only half the experience; sound completes the immersion. AmbientSounds 6 is a cornerstone of this pack, transforming silent biomes into vibrant ecosystems. Walk through a forest and hear birds chirping, or descend into a cave to hear the eerie drip of water and distant echoes. This audio layer makes the world feel vast and breathing. On the practical side, the pack is loaded with essential quality-of-life improvements. Mods like JEI and JER allow for instant recipe lookups, while Mouse Tweaks and Searchables make inventory management a breeze. Features like Chat Heads help identify speakers in multiplayer, and AppleSkin gives you precise hunger data, removing unnecessary guesswork from your survival adventures.
Performance and Compatibility
A common concern with enhanced visuals is frame rate drops, but CozyCorners is engineered for efficiency. By leveraging Sodium for massive FPS boosts and Iris Shaders for optimized rendering, the pack ensures that beauty does not come at the cost of performance. It runs seamlessly on the Fabric loader, utilizing Fabric API and Fabric Language Kotlin to maintain stability across different updates. This optimization makes it an ideal choice for long gaming sessions or hosting cozy SMP servers where lag can ruin the vibe.

How to Install and Get Started
Getting started is straightforward for players familiar with modded Minecraft. First, ensure you have the correct version of the Fabric loader installed for your target game version, as CozyCorners is optimized for specific recent releases. Once your loader is ready, you can download CozyCorners from trusted mod repositories. Extract the files into your mods folder, making sure all dependencies like Fabric API are present. If you are unsure about the process, searching for how to install specific Fabric mods will yield detailed guides, but the simplicity of this pack means fewer steps than most technical modpacks.
- Install the latest recommended version of Fabric Loader.
- Download the CozyCorners modpack file and dependency mods.
- Place all .jar files into the "mods" folder within your Minecraft directory.
- Launch the game using the Fabric profile and select your preferred shader pack in the video settings.
